Output 4efa85ea24aaea2d9b073368cc7d1e866e074f4f28fc738ebbeb55538e040b96:1

value
22907048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c59f22495c56005846c3bda59023e1d3c97ed45 OP_EQUALVERIFY OP_CHECKSIG
address
1JAuncYPkVEy6fUBi7PG6RKnieHxu5oirq
transaction
4efa85ea24aaea2d9b073368cc7d1e866e074f4f28fc738ebbeb55538e040b96
confirmations
475922
spent
true